回答編集履歴
1
加筆修正
test
CHANGED
@@ -18,11 +18,11 @@
|
|
18
18
|
|
19
19
|
みたいな流れになるのではないかと。
|
20
20
|
|
21
|
-
エラーメッセージを管理する、例えば
|
21
|
+
エラーメッセージを管理する、例えば投稿データのチェックを行う前に
|
22
22
|
|
23
23
|
`$err_msgs = [];`
|
24
24
|
|
25
|
-
なんて
|
25
|
+
なんていうエラーメッセージ管理用配列変数を用意して、
|
26
26
|
|
27
27
|
内容がないなどのソフトなエラーを例えば
|
28
28
|
|
@@ -33,3 +33,21 @@
|
|
33
33
|
一連のチェック処理が終わったときに
|
34
34
|
|
35
35
|
`count($err_msgs)`が0のままならエラーなしとみなせるんではないかと。
|
36
|
+
|
37
|
+
0よりも大きければ、例えば
|
38
|
+
|
39
|
+
```
|
40
|
+
|
41
|
+
foreach ($err_msgs as $msg) {
|
42
|
+
|
43
|
+
echo $msg . '<br />' . PHP_EOL;
|
44
|
+
|
45
|
+
}
|
46
|
+
|
47
|
+
```
|
48
|
+
|
49
|
+
みたいにすればエラーメッセージも表示できますし。
|
50
|
+
|
51
|
+
(投稿フォームの入力欄の近くにエラーメッセージを表示しないときは
|
52
|
+
|
53
|
+
また違った工夫をこらさないといけないでしょうけども。)
|